Updated information: The Minnesota Department of Transportation has cancelled the weekend daytime closures for the 36th Avenue bridge painting, originally scheduled for Oct. 26-27. Instead, crews will be completing surface finish repairs on the bridge, requiring lane closures.
Beginning 4 a.m. Saturday, Oct. 26, southbound Highway 169 will be reduced to one lane between Rockford Road and Medicine Lake Road until 2 p.m.
Then, beginning 4 a.m. Sunday, Oct. 27, northbound Highway 169 will be reduced to one lane between Rockford Road and Medicine Lake Road until 2 p.m.
